Abstract
The invention discloses a kind of flow-type water purifier technology, it is related to technical field of water purification.It included drainage, water inlet, preposition PP cottons, preposition activated charcoal filtration apparatus, postposition PP cottons, booster pump reverse osmosis (RO) film, traffic handler, pressure pot, post active carbon filtration apparatus, tap.The present invention in water purifier by increasing traffic handler, user loads onto use, enterprise or agent can set rational filtering traffic before the use regimen condition of backstage real time monitoring to user, product export according to different filter cores, then the working time of current statistical system monitoring booster pump, with this come the water consumption that converts, when filter core usage amount reaches replacement, background system can be shown, back office provides free replacement service of visiting to the user that filter core needs replacing, and meets the needs of people.

Embodiment
To make the technical means, the creative features, the aims and the efficiencies achieved by the present invention easy to understand, with reference to
Embodiment, the present invention is further explained.
With reference to Fig. 1, present embodiment uses following technical scheme:A kind of flow-type water purifier technology, its feature exist
In, including drainage 1, water inlet 2, preposition PP cottons 3, preposition activated charcoal filtration apparatus 4, postposition PP cottons 5, booster pump 6 are reverse osmosis excessively
RO films 7, traffic handler 8, pressure pot 9, post active carbon filtration apparatus 10, tap 11;Cross drainage 1 by water inlet 2 into
Enter preposition PP cottons 3, preposition activated charcoal filtration apparatus 4 is flowed to after preposition PP cottons 3 are filtered, by preposition activated charcoal filtration apparatus
Postposition PP cottons 5 are flowed to after 4 filterings, connection booster pump 6 enters back into traffic handler 8, flow processing after postposition PP cottons 5 are filtered
Device 8 is sequentially connected reverse osmosis (RO) film 7 and pressure pot 9, crosses drainage 1 and flows to post active carbon filtration apparatus 10 by pressure pot 9, most
Discharged afterwards by tap 11.
It is worth noting that, the traffic handler 8 includes traffic statistics chip and wireless communication module, traffic statistics core
The data of piece are sent in server by wireless communication module, and wireless communication module is GPRS communication module, 3G/4G is communicated
Module and wifi module combination.
With reference to Fig. 2, the flow rate calculation chip for being equipped with independent identification in the water purifier of every user, flow rate calculation chip
Data are sent in remote server by wireless communication module after statistics, remote server is passing through display after data statistics
Terminal informs the service condition of user and back office, after traffic handler reaches the flow specified, is sent to back office,
Back office contacts corresponding client by the independent identification of user, informs and needs replacing filter core, takes replacement service of visiting,
Ensure the safety of water quality.And backstage can be controlled according to user information to the power supply of corresponding booster pump, the unlatching of control device and stop
Shut down, such as unpaid time-consuming arrestment uses.
